Abstract

PURPOSE:To contrive the reduction of electric power consumption and noise and the improvement of the durability of a cooling fan by detecting the commencement/completion of recording and reproducing and operating/stopping the cooling fan accordingly. CONSTITUTION:When a sensor 1 detects the insertion of an information recording carrier, its detecting signal is outputted to a D-type FF circuit 2. The circuit 2 turns on a cooling fan driving switch 4 upon receipt of the output of the sensor 1. Consequently, the fan 6 is supplied with an electric power from a driving electric power source 5 to start the operation. Then, on completion of recording or reproducing, the sensor 1 detects the ejection of the information recording carrier, so as to turn off the switch 4 via the circuit 2. Therefore, the fan 6 is only driven when the information recording carrier is inserted, thus reducing the electric power consumption and noise and also improving the durability of the cooling fan.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Industrial Field of Application] The present invention relates to an information recording/reproducing device equipped with a cooling fan for suppressing heat generation during operation of the device.

[Prior Art] There are two types of information recording and reproducing devices: optical and magnetic.In recent years, the optical type has attracted attention due to its large storage capacity and other reasons. All of these information recording and reproducing apparatuses employ a method of making effective use of the recording area on the surface of the information recording carrier by linearly reciprocating or rotating the information recording carrier. However, the electric motor for linearly reciprocating or rotating the information recording carrier consumes more power than other information processing systems.Therefore, in order to suppress the heat generated by the electric motor, a cooling fan is used to reduce the heat generation part. Cooling is performed, and conventionally, the driving of this cooling fan is started when the information recording/reproducing apparatus is powered on and stopped when the information recording/reproducing apparatus is powered off.

[Problems to be solved by the invention] However, in an information recording/reproducing device, power consumption increases only while an information recording carrier is attached, and power consumption does not increase as much while on standby, requiring cooling. However, in the conventional method, as long as the power is on, the cooling fan continues to operate even when no information storage carrier is installed, which conversely increases power consumption and causes noise. Become. Furthermore, driving the cooling fan at times other than when necessary has the problem of accelerating the wear and tear of the motor of the cooling fan.

FIG. 1 is a block circuit diagram of a cooling fan drive circuit of an information recording and reproducing apparatus according to the present invention, in which the output of a sensor I is connected to a clock input terminal T of a D-type flip-flop circuit 2, and a reset switch is connected to the clock input terminal T of a D-type flip-flop circuit 2. Reference numeral 3 denotes a switch which is turned on and off according to the power on and off of the information recording and reproducing apparatus, and its output is connected to the reset terminal R of the D-type flip-flop circuit 2. An output terminal Q of the D-type flip-flop circuit 2 is connected to a data input inverting terminal and a cooling fan drive switch 4. Further, a cooling fan driving power source 5 is connected to an electric motor of a cooling fan 6 via a cooling fan driving switch 4 .

The sensor l is composed of, for example, a photo interrupter, a photo reflector, etc., and generates one pulse signal when the information recording carrier is inserted and ejected. Further, the reset switch 3 is operated in conjunction with the power switch of the device, and the cooling fan drive switch 4 is turned off when the output of the D-type flip-flop circuit 2 is at a low level, and turned on when it is at a high level. First, when the information recording/reproducing apparatus is powered off, the reset switch 3 is in an OFF state, so the D-type flip-flop circuit 2 is in a reset state. Therefore, the circuit does not operate and the cooling fan drive switch 4 is in an open state, and the cooling fan 6 is not supplied with power and is not driven.Next, when the information recording and reproducing apparatus is powered on, the reset switch 3 is turned on. state, press reset switch 3.
is released from the reset state. However, when no information recording carrier is inserted, no pulse is output from the sensor 1 and the output of the D-type flip-flop circuit 2 is at a low level, so the cooling fan drive switch 4 is open and the cooling fan 6 is driven. do not.

Therefore, the cooling fan 6 receives power from the driving power source 5 and starts operating. On the other hand, the electric motor 8 also starts driving, the pulley 9 rotates, and its power is transmitted to the rollers 11a and 12a via the power transmission member 10. Furthermore, the information recording carrier is pushed in so that the tip of the information recording carrier is pushed into the roller lla.
, flb, then roller ll
It is guided by a, flb, 12a, and 12b and sent further into the depths.

When the recording and reproduction of information is completed by a known method, the information recording carrier is ejected in the direction of the insertion lower. At this time, the sensor 1 detects the ejection of the information recording carrier again and activates the D-type flip-flop circuit 2 and the electric motor 41. Outputs the detection signal to the drive circuit of !8. The electric motor 8 stops driving, and the output of the D-type flip-flop circuit 2 becomes low level. Therefore, the cooling fan drive switch 4 becomes open, and the cooling fan 6 stops operating. In this way, the cooling fan 6 can be driven only when the information recording carrier is inserted, that is, when the electric motor 8 is driven.

In this embodiment, the cooling fan 6 is driven and stopped by the output of the sensor l provided near the insertion lower, but other means may also be used. It is also possible to adopt a configuration in which the cooling fan 6 is driven and stopped by determining the presence or absence of an information recording carrier near the head or whether or not the recording/reproducing head is energized. Further, in this embodiment, the cooling fan 6 is stopped at the same time as the information recording carrier is ejected, but if the cooling fan 6 is configured to be stopped after a certain period of time after the information recording carrier is ejected, the number of times the cooling fan 6 is started can be reduced. The load upon starting the cooling fan 6 can be reduced. Furthermore, if the set time is set to a time sufficient for cooling the equipment, a more effective cooling effect can be obtained.
